About the Role :

The EHS Specialist will work with management to ensure a safe and healthy work environment and will be responsible for the effective implementation of all EHS processes. The role oversees compliance with all EHS laws and regulations. This position also serves as the primary contact for any EHS inspections and / or audits.

What You'll Do :

  • Reviews, updates and implements EHS policies, programs and procedures in compliance with local, state, and federal rules and regulations
  • Maintains all EHS activity files and records and acts as the Custodian of Records for all EHS documents
  • Interacts with all outside regulatory agencies for audits and inspections; secures all necessary permits
  • Evaluates wastewater treatment process daily and authenticates the process checklist
  • Negotiates with vendors for pricing of services
  • Generates and maintains the SDS for all hazardous materials
  • Responsible for all local agency compliance as follows :

OC CUPA

  • Handles all paperwork for annual permit renewal
  • Creates records of all discharged materials in compliance with all federal, state and local regulations
  • Oversees the semi-annual Fire Department inspection and the implementation of any required action items
  • Monitors all chemical inventory lists in the designated chemical storage areas and reviews CERS for hazardous materials; generates CERS and maintains the records for any new materials
  • Completes REACH Questionnaire Forms per customer's requirement
  • Submits the annual closure plan
  • SC AQMD

  • Handles all paperwork for the annual permit renewal
  • Submits the quarterly report
  • Monitors all pertinent regulations on a periodic basis and implements changes as required
  • Participates in the annual AQMD training
  • OC Sanitation District

  • Collects data and completes self-monitoring reports on a monthly basis for the OCSD Class 1 permit; handles all paperwork to renew the annual permit
  • Submits monthly, quarterly, semi-annual and annual reports per the District's schedule
  • Completes the stormwater sampling inspections after each rain event or at least twice a year utilizing the service vendor; prepares and submits inspection reports and maintains all records
  • OSHA

  • Submits annual OSHA injury log report
  • Responsible for all federal and state OSHA compliance
  • Other

  • Submits reports to the BOE as required
  • Schedules and conducts all safety trainings including forklift training and new hire safety orientation
  • Reviews, updates, and develops training materials including demonstration kits and presentation materials
  • Identifies the training requirement for all the process areas; creates an annual training plan and a training tracking sheet
  • Develops and maintains all safety policies, programs and procedures (SOP)
  • Conducts daily walkthrough safety inspections to ensure compliance of Company safety policies and procedures; documents findings and implements all necessary action items
  • Conducts formal semi-annual onsite safety inspection audit; implements all necessary action items and maintains all records
  • Conducts annual emergency drills and maintains all records
  • Conducts monthly safety committee meetings; communicates with managers and team leaders about safety issues; suggests and implements any necessary changes
  • Checks and refills first aid kits every two weeks and orders supplies every month
  • Communicates regularly with Safety Liaisons in each process areas; solicits feedback for improvements or changes; implements all action items as needed
  • Handles all work related injuries and takes injured worker to the designated clinic or hospital
  • Conducts and documents all accident, injury and incident investigations; prepares root cause analysis; determines and implements corrective action items as needed
  • Maintains and renews all required EHS related certifications
  • Performs all other duties as needed
